Fraser Immigration Law PLLC has released a new guide aimed at early-career researchers seeking to strengthen their National Interest Waiver (NIW) petitions. The guide, published by Shaune D. Fraser, challenges the common belief that applicants need extensive citations or senior credentials to qualify for NIW approval.
Key Details:
- The guide addresses misconceptions about citation counts and emphasizes strategic positioning within the Dhanasar framework.
- Topics include why NIW may be more suitable than EB-1A for early-career researchers.
- It provides insights on demonstrating qualifications through trajectory and resources.
- The guide also discusses how to leverage H-1B status as evidence of contributions to nationally important work.
This resource is particularly beneficial for researchers who have been advised they are “not ready yet” for NIW applications, offering them actionable strategies to enhance their chances of approval.
